State Committee on religious affairs set up

President Aliyev decreed Friday to set up the State Committee on religious affairs in lieu of the religious department under the Cabinet of Ministers. The challenges the new committee is facing include control over the observance of legal acts pertaining to the freedom of religion and state registration of religious entities.
The committee has the authority to intervene in the work of religious organizations to the extent envisioned by law. However, the committee cannot intervene in issues of the freedom of religion and provide financial assistance to religious organizations. A renowned Oriental researcher, Dr. Prof. Rafiq Aliyev has been appointed as chairman of the committee.
Religious life needs state regulation
Speaking of the importance of the newly-established State Committee on religious affairs in an interview with AssA-Irada, its chairman Rafiq Aliyev said the rampant spread of religious sects and movements had necessitated the introduction of state regulation of inter-confessional relations. He stated that the state must take the monopoly into its hands. The committee is expected to regulate and closely cooperate with all confessions, including Muslim, Christian and Jewish. Asked about the dangerous proportions the propaganda of Wahabism and Islamic extremism is assuming in Azerbaijan, R. Aliyev said it is not Islamic extremism that matters, as any kind of extremism is perilous. The committee will deal with the problem, but it is first necessary to thoroughly study the religious situation in the country before a work plan can be developed, he said.
Dr. Aliyev, 54, was born in 1947 in Agdam. He has graduated from the Oriental Studies Faculty of Baku State University, is a well-known researcher of the Arab world, Doctor, Professor. Dr. Aliyev was deputy director of the Institute for Oriental Studies under the Azerbaijan Academy of Sciences. At present, he is director of "Irshad", the Islamic Research Center, and author of 8 books and over 100 religious works. Dr. Aliyev spent many years working in Yemen, Algeria and Syria.
Dr. Aliyev is also known beyond Azerbaijan, as he is a member of the Scientific Council for African studies under the Russian Academy of Sciences, the Azerbaijan representative of the International Inter-Confessional Federation headquartered in New York and Seoul, and a member of the International Information Academy based in Moscow and New York
He is married with two children and a grandchild.
